Output e6a00583307dfa51ba8018eb36133615366eb214aa2b8f1da35b3057098f898e:0

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c143d8f6738c90f57f61de3fb34c814f0edf36c OP_EQUAL
address
3QftTDZtL2ob7CK2jGQa7pasxtH6tn2LeK
transaction
e6a00583307dfa51ba8018eb36133615366eb214aa2b8f1da35b3057098f898e
spent
true